What are signs your AC unit needs to be repaired?

Contact an AC repair pro if you notice the following signs:

  • Rising energy bills: If your energy bill is significantly higher than usual or keeps increasing, your AC system may be the cause.
  • Inconsistent temperatures: Your AC system should keep your entire home at a consistent temperature. Major fluctuations in temperature from one room to the next could point to a problem with your HVAC.
  • Inaccurate thermostat readings: The temperature inside your home should match the thermostat. Mismatched temperature readings could indicate a problem with your AC system or thermostat.
  • Leaks around the AC unit: Moisture around your air conditioning system is a problem that warrants professional diagnosis. It could be due to leaking refrigerant or water from a broken tube.
  • Weird noises: AC systems generate some noise, but loud sounds or unusual noises, such as screeching, clicking or bubbling, can point to a serious issue.
  • Strange odors: An air conditioner will typically give off a smell after going unused for months, but it's unusual for an in-use AC to develop a sudden odd smell.
  • Weak airflow: A sign your AC may need repairs is weak airflow. An inefficient AC or blockage could cause weak airflow.
  • Warm air: Your home's ductwork could have an issue, or your system's compressor could be low on refrigerant if your AC is circulating warm air.
  • Frequent cycles: Your AC cycling on and off more often than usual may be a sign of an issue. Your system should turn on more frequently on warmer days, but it shouldn’t do so constantly during the day.

How do you choose the best AC repair company in Hamden?

The following factors can help you pick the best AC repair company in Hamden.

Make sure the company is licensed in Connecticut

Only hire properly licensed and insured AC repair technicians. The Connecticut Department of Consumer Protection requires HVAC contractors to maintain proper licensing. Other requirements include a surety or cash bond and worker’s compensation insurance. Additionally, the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) requires all HVAC technicians who handle refrigerants to be certified.

Look for national accreditations

While not required, there are national accreditations for AC pros, such as the Air Conditioning Contractors of America (ACCA) and the American Society of Heating, Refrigerating, and Air Conditioning Engineers (ASHRAE). Having a certification from one of these professional organizations offers proof of a technician's skill and knowledge in the industry.

Get a free estimate

Most AC repair companies offer free estimates. This includes an in-person assessment during which the AC repair pro suggests solutions and gives you a quote. Pay close attention to how thorough the technician is during the assessment.

Compare costs

Ask for detailed, itemized estimates from multiple companies. Multiple estimates will give you a better sense of the average price range in your area. Be wary of offers that are too high or too low.

Assess experience

Ask if the technician has experience servicing your kind of AC system. Some HVAC pros specialize in certain types of systems, whereas others have more generalized experience.

Read reviews

Ask your friends and family for personal recommendations for AC repair companies. Always look up online reviews for professionals you're considering hiring.

Read comments from previous customers to better understand the company's customer service and work quality, and keep an eye out for consistently bad reviews or a recent uptick in negative feedback.

What are popular types of AC units in Hamden?

Below are the types of AC units you can typically find in Hamden homes, along with which homes they work best for:

  • Central: Standard central AC units are common in Hamden, as they efficiently cool your entire home.
  • Ductless mini-split: The ductless mini-split offers zoned cooling without the need for ductwork.
  • Hybrid: Hybrid systems both heat and cool your home by combining heat pumps with furnaces.
  • Heat pumps: Heat pumps are less prevalent in Connecticut, because electric heating is more expensive in colder climates.
